Didn't realise there was a thread for this!
I reserved my shared ownership property back in July with an expected completion date of early September. In August I was told I needed a cladding report and I've been waiting ever since!
Got a report in early December but was told that it wasn't acceptable. Got a new report last week so hopefully this one will do the trick!
The seller is pushing me to get a mortgage through a different bank, because apparently lots of other people have completed with mortgages from other banks, and the cladding hasn't been a concern. I've dug my heels in since I'd rather have the report in case it's needed when I sell.

got a message from our broker
barclays have now sent form EWS1 to be filled by the developer /management company
does this means things may start moving again or it a false dawn
in our case the fire testing has happened in sep but for some weird reason report is not being released0 -
My understanding is this will help places with non combustible cladding. If it’s cladding that needs to be replaced because of safety issues, they still won’t lend. I’m not hopeful it will help my situation but will certainly explore it!0
